Clive D.W. Feather wrote:

>>But I'm not going to argue too strongly against 
>>this and I'll just use "383 =" as an empty challenge.
> 
> 
> Query: would "383 ====" be better, so that base64 parsers can always grab a
> 4-character chunk? [Ditto elsewhere.]

Neither "=" nor "====" are valid base64, so the length doesn't matter. 
The idea is that the protocol parser would trap this before blindly 
passing it onto the base64 decoder.  Since "=" is documented as an empty 
initial response in SMTP, POP3 and IMAP, I'd rather stick with it for NNTP.
